<!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(190) [player_tooltip player_id='3343952' first='AJ' last='Clarke'] | PF | Murray</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>Clarke is a bouncy, athletic 6-4 forward who does a great job protecting the rim, averaging 2.7 blocks per game. He has great timing as a shot blocker, and a really good second jump that he uses to compete on the glass on both ends of the floor. His 15.6 points, 6.8 rebounds, and 2.5 steals also lead the Mustangs.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(198) [player_tooltip player_id='2845971' first='Lucas' last='Helgeland'] | SF | Lake Mills</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>A 6-2 wing who is shooting a blistering 46.2% from the 3-point line, Helgeland has emerged as a reliable second scoring threat for the Bulldogs in his junior year, averaging 14.5 points per game. His 6.5 rebounds lead the team. </p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(207) [player_tooltip player_id='2853953' first='Peyton' last='Amdor'] | SF | Riverside</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>Amdor is a 6-2 wing who leads the Bulldogs in scoring at 18.1 points per game. He's a strong three-level scorer who can get to the rim off the dribble, and he has made a team-high 27 3-pointers so far this season.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(211) [player_tooltip player_id='2822660' first='Holden' last='Hughes'] | PF | WACO</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>An efficient 6-4 forward, Hughes is averaging 15.1 points and 8.3 rebounds per game, both tops for the Warriors. He's a good finisher around the rim, shooting 52% from the floor, and is capable of stepping out and occasionally knocking down a 3, burying 11 of his 25 attempts so far this season.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(215) [player_tooltip player_id='2756998' first='Alex' last='Kruger'] | F | Sibley-Ocheyedan</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>A big, physical 6-6 forward, Kruger is putting up 13.6 points and 6.3 rebounds per game on 44-37-77 shooting splits. He does a great job carving out space in the paint, and is a good rim protector, turning away over a shot per game.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(217) [player_tooltip player_id='2853853' first='Coy' last='Moline'] | SF | Manson-Northwest Webster</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>Moline is a volume scorer, a 6-3 wing who is putting up 18.2 points and 8.5 rebounds per game, leading the Cougars in both categories. He does a good job using his strength to bully his way to the rim, where he finishes well.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(221) [player_tooltip player_id='2854041' first='Landon' last='Wigington'] | C | Underwood</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>A 6-4/6-5 big man, Wigington has been great on the glass for the Eagles, averaging 8.2 rebounds per game, including 2.7 a game on the offensive end. In addition to his prowess on the glass, he's averaging 13.8 points per game on 64% shooting.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(225) [player_tooltip player_id='3343992' first='Waylon' last='Raue'] | SF | North Linn</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>A 6-4 wing with good size and length on the perimeter, Raue has stepped right into the Lynx rotation as a junior and given them a quality third scoring option. He's averaging 10.6 points, 6.3 rebounds, 2.4 assists, and 2.7 steals per game while shooting 37% from behind the arc.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(228) [player_tooltip player_id='3343999' first='Dane' last='Strong'] | SF | Montezuma</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>Strong is a strong, athletic 6-1 forward who controls the glass on both ends of the floor for the Braves, averaging a team-high 7.8 rebounds per game. He's a tough finisher around the rim, versatile defender, and willing passer. He's putting up 14.5 points per game, second for Montezuma.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(230) [player_tooltip player_id='3344376' first='Preston' last='Louters'] | SF | Western Christian</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>A long, skilled 6-3 wing who understands the game at a high level, Louters has been really productive for the Wolfpack as a junior, averaging 10.8 points, 3.5 rebounds, and 2.0 assists on 54-39-83 shooting splits. He has the size and high release to shoot over defenders, and his length and IQ allow him to provide some versatility on the defensive end.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(238) [player_tooltip player_id='3344399' first='Lincoln' last='Roethler'] | SF | Denver</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>Roethler is a 6-3 wing who can score efficiently around the bucket and in the mid-range. He's averaging 10.2 points and 5.9 rebounds per game for the Cyclones on 45% shooting.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(245) [player_tooltip player_id='3344411' first='Bennett' last='Stecker'] | PF | Spirit Lake</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>A 6-5 combo forward who can score inside and out, Stecker is averaging 14.8 points, 8.5 rebounds, and 2.1 steals per game on 49-39-65 shooting splits for the Indians. He has a pure stroke out to the arc and good touch around the rim.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(246) [player_tooltip player_id='3344413' first='Abner' last='Zaugg'] | C | West Bend-Mallard</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>A 6-5 big man who can protect the rim defensively as well as control the glass, Zaugg is averaging 15.3 points, 8.6 rebounds, 2.3 assists, and 1.9 blocks per game for the Wolverines. He does a great job letting his size do the work on the defensive end, contesting shots without fouling.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(247) [player_tooltip player_id='3344414' first='Carson' last='Newcomb'] | SF | Prince of Peace</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>Following the graduation of Hakael Powell, a lot of shots opened up for the Irish, and Newcomb has taken advantage of that. He's leading the team in scoring at 15.4 points per game to go with 4.9 rebounds, 2.0 assists, and 1.1 steals.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p><strong>(248) [player_tooltip player_id='3344417' first='Marcus' last='Pedersen'] | PF | Ankeny Christian Academy</strong></p> <!-- /wp:paragraph --> <!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>A 6-3 forward having a breakout junior year, Pedersen leads the Eagles in scoring (14.3) and has been incredibly efficient, shooting 64% from the floor.</p> <!-- /wp:paragraph -->
